Philosophy
Our children and youth are a precious and essential part of our Congregation. Our goal is to create a place where children feel safe, valued and loved for who they are; and to nurture their growing faith through worship, education, fellowship and service.


Sunday school is offered during our 10 a.m. worship service to children in preschool through Grade 8. It meets every Sunday except for the last Sunday of each month, which is when we have our Together-As-One, Family Worship Service.

Communion Sunday Service Dates
On the first Sunday of each month the Sunday school children receive communion in Walker Chapel, just as the adults do in the Meetinghouse. After being dismissed during the 10AM service the children go directly to Walker Chapel, where each class sits together for communion. After a short service, the children go to their classes with their teachers until 11:15 a.m.

Bible Sunday
This is a special occasion for children in third grade who are presented with their first Holy Bible, and children age 3 (who are starting their first year of Sunday school) are presented with a Bible for preschoolers during worship. Children receive their Bibles the last Sunday in September during worship service.

Nursery Care
Our nursery is a safe, fun and nurturing environment for children from birth to age 3. Nursery care is available during our 10 a.m. worship service from 9:45 to 11:15. Nursery care is also available during holiday services.

Confirmation
Confirmation at First Congregational Church is for all students, 9th grade and older, who are interested in learning more about the Church and their faith. Confirmation is a nine-month course of study leading to the student's decision to become a member of the First Congregational Church of Branford. Classes are Sunday evenings, 5:00 - 6:00 p.m., with the Rev. Gary Smith.
